Gastown’s iconic weekly summer series is back with another round of car-free fun 

15 June 20263 Mins Read

Vancouver’s most historic neighbourhood is getting a fun car-free summer series starting this July. After its successful inaugural year last year, Gastown Sunday Set is back and better than ever, transforming the cobblestone streets of Gastown into a lively, car-free hub.

The iconic pedestrian zone experience is inspired by global movements like Paris Breathes, and as such, it will make Gastown truly come alive all summer long.

Organized by the Gastown Business Improvement Society (GBIS), the popular series creates numerous third spaces for locals and visitors alike to connect, whether it’s at a drag show, a dance battle, or a live mural painting. Given Vancouver’s status as a FIFA World Cup host city, these spaces will be all the more crucial to building community this upcoming season.

Unlike a standard street closure, each Sunday session will be designed to offer something new and different. So no two visits will be the same!

“Gastown Sunday Set exceeded our expectations in its first year, and we’re thrilled to bring it back with even more energy and programming,” says Elise Yurkowski, executive director for the GBIS. “These weekly activations are about more than events, they’re about building community, celebrating what makes Gastown unlike anywhere else, and inviting everyone to slow down and experience these streets in a whole new way.”

Neighbourhood coffee parties, art crawls, and more

From July 5 to Sept. 6, Gastown will turn into a high-energy, car-free neighbourhood every Sunday, with tons of fun activations and live performances to explore each week.

This includes coffee parties, a vibrant outdoor flower market, and so much more.

Here are all the rotating events you can check out at Gastown Sunday Set this summer:

Streetside Sessions: Coffee Party

Taking place on July 5, Aug. 9, and Sept. 6, 2026, this fun series will be hosted in collaboration with Public Disco, inviting visitors to experience Gastown through its famed coffee scene. Here, you’ll be able to enjoy locally roasted coffee and curated sets from Vancouver-based DJs.

So if sipping your way through Gastown’s coffee shops sounds like your cup of tea (pun intended), this is the event for you.

Gastown in Bloom: Flower Market

Gastown in Bloom is back with a vibrant outdoor flower market that spills into Gastown’s historic streets. Created in partnership with local florists and plant shops, the event invites visitors to stroll, shop local, and immerse themselves in this botanical promenade.

You can check it out for yourself on July 12, 26, and Aug. 23, 2026.

Open Air Atelier: Live Art Battles

Taking place on July 19, Aug. 2, and 30, 2026, Open Air Atelier is a live art competition that reimagines Gastown as an open-air art crawl. Emerging artists will be set up across the neighbourhood, creating original pieces that will compete for the public’s vote.

Gastown Unscripted: Letting Water Street Breathe

This relaxed Sunday session (Aug. 16, 2026) will lean into Water Street’s natural charm, with informal activations taking place throughout the day between Richards and Columbia Streets.

As always, the GBIS will work closely with the City to ensure attendee safety throughout each Sunday Set.

Mark your calendars!

When: July 5 to Sept. 6, 2026
Time: 1 to 6 p.m.
Where: Water Street in Gastown 
Cost: Free admission
